  1. Since we assume each string is the same length and at the same tension, our focus will be on the mass per unit length. A thicker string will have greater mass per unit length (ho ho).

  2. Thus, since ho ho is greater for a thicker string, it impacts the frequency:

    • A greater ho ho results in a smaller value of ff, indicating that the frequency of the thicker string is lower.
  3. Conclusion: A thicker string will produce a note of lower frequency compared to a thinner string, since it has greater mass per unit length and the same tension.
